underhood working on the 93 up Camaro/Firebird
Since I am beginning with a clean paper, just how tough is the 93 up F body for under hood work? I am building an IHRA Crate Motor combo, small block with carb. Let me hear from racers who are doing under hood work on these cars.
Thanks |
Re: underhood working on the 93 up Camaro/Firebird
Seems I've had a few of these..........not too bad to work on but forget about taking the pan off easily.

Re: underhood working on the 93 up Camaro/Firebird
Bone stock they can be a absolute nightmare for some jobs I think book time is close to 3 hours for plugs and wires. But after you get all the junk out that you take out of a racecar they are pretty easy to work on. I know the factory service manual reads that you have to drop the k-member and take the engine out the bottom, But I have changed many of these engines in both factory street cars and in my racecars with aftermarket k members and I have yet to remove the K member to do so. Like I said before once you get all the junk out they are easy to work on start by taking the heater assembly out it frees up a ton of room to work on the passengers side.
For oil pan removal I use a tool that is designed for working on front wheel drives. It lays across both stut towers and then you hook a chain from it down to a header bolt on each side. After that just remove the engine mount bolts and the bolts holding the K member and pry it down to get enoughf room to slip the pan out. Its a little tight but a whole lot faster than pulling the engine |
